摘要

It was attempted in this study to determine the effect of former farmland soils on biomechanics and stability of trees by analyzing axial variation in basic density of wood, bending strength of absolutely dry wood and that of wood with moisture content over fiber saturation point.The analyses were conducted on wood of Scots pines grown on four positions in northern Poland coming from mature stands aged from 97 to 102 years, growing on former farmland and on forest soils. Results showed significant differences in terms of wood properties analyzed in this study between compared groups of trees and at the same time indicated different stability of stands growing on former farmland soils in relation to trees growing on forest soils.
